Child Protective Services expert witnesses specialize in a variety of fields, including social work, family law, child psychology, and child abuse prevention. Some of the most common specialties among Child Protective Services expert witnesses also include foster care systems, child neglect cases, adoption processes, and domestic violence situations. They have provided opinions on the effects of parental rights termination, child custody disputes, allegations of child abuse or neglect, the impact of domestic violence on children, and the effectiveness of Child Protective Services interventions.

FAQs for Child Protective Services Expert Witnesses

What is the role of a Child Protective Services expert witness?

A Child Protective Services expert witness provides insight into cases involving child abuse, neglect, foster care, and adoption based on their knowledge and experience in the field.

In what types of cases can a Child Protective Services expert witness be beneficial?

These experts are crucial in cases involving child abuse, neglect, custody disputes, foster care issues, and adoption processes. They provide valuable insights to help determine the best interests of the child.

What subspecialties exist within the realm of Child Protective Services expertise?

Subspecialties can include child psychology, social work, family law, pediatric medicine, and education. Each offers unique perspectives in different case scenarios.

How can a Child Protective Services expert witness assist in a child neglect case?

An expert can evaluate evidence, assess parental capabilities, and provide an informed opinion on whether neglect has occurred and its impact on the child's wellbeing.

Why is it important to have a Child Protective Services expert witness with experience in foster care systems?

Such an expert understands the intricacies of foster care systems and can assess if they meet standards for safety and wellbeing of children placed under their care.
